/ / Тип даних доходу в mysql? - mysql, database-design

Введіть дані доходу в mysql? - mysql, database-design

Я створюю сторінки компанії. Одне з полів - "Дохід". Так що це може варіюватися від 0 до, я думаю, сотні мільярдів. Отже, у цьому полі має бути тип даних bigint? Або чи є кращий спосіб зберігати доходи в базі даних? Використання MySQL.

Відповіді:

1 для відповіді № 1

Подивіться на DECIMAL тип даних.


0 для відповіді № 2

Я б використовував bigint і зберігав ваші цифри доходів у копійках, а не в десятках. Тоді ви уникнете округлення питань.


0 для відповіді № 3

Спробуйте цифровий чи десятковий. The DECIMAL і NUMERIC Типи зберігають точні числові значення даних. Ці типи використовуються, коли важливо зберегти точну точність, наприклад, з грошовими даними.

Перевір це: Типи даних MySQL